Jinling Mandarin Garden Hotel Nanjing
About this hotel
Luxury hotel with 12 restaurants connected to a shopping center in Nanjing This smoke-free hotel features 12 restaurants, an indoor pool, and a fitness center. Free WiFi in public areas and free self parking are also provided. Additionally, a bar/lounge, a sauna, and a conference center are onsite. Jinling Mandarin Garden Hotel Nanjing offers 340 air-conditioned accommodations with minibars (stocked with some free items) and safes. LCD televisions come with satellite channels. Bathrooms include separate bathtubs and showers with rainfall showerheads, slippers, complimentary toiletries, and hair dryers. This Nanjing hotel provides complimentary wireless Internet access. Business-friendly amenities include desks and phones. Additionally, rooms include coffee/tea makers and irons/ironing boards. Housekeeping is provided daily. Recreational amenities at the hotel include an indoor pool, a sauna, and a fitness center.

I ended up not staying in this hotel after having paid for 2 nights. The place was dirty - mould and stains on the carpet, and a whiff of bad smell in the room. I was offered an upgrade to the best rooms - God bless the staff - but it didn't change my mind because the condition of the place is not up to five-star standard. It's below 3 star. Apart from the filth, the rooms and the lobby are poorly appointed, cheesy and gaudy and full of noisy people. The location is good because the hotel is in right next to the Confucius Temple area with all the shops and next to the Qin-Huai river.
